Why you should never hang your handbags?

Refrain from hanging your bags — this will distort the shape of the handles. If you have it, store your bag in its original box. Otherwise, line your bags up on a shelf in your closet.

How often should you clean your purse?

If you use your handbag every day, clean it every two to three months. For special occasion purses, a good cleaning every six to nine months should suffice. Take the time to clean your bags properly.

How long should a good handbag last?

Leather in itself will can for 100 years before it begins to disintegrate, and most people won’t be keeping their bag for that long. However you can expect a good quality bag, made from full grain leather, that is oiled regularly and stored carefully to last upwards of 30 years.

Where do you put your purse at home?

You can place hooks on doors, with the inside of a closet door being a prime spot. You also can mount hooks in a row on the wall to keep your bags visible and within easy reach. Just make sure to keep the bags hanging neatly if they’re not behind a closed door. And don’t hang them somewhere you’ll often bump into them.

How do you clean a leather bag without washing it?

Cleaning a Leather Purse To clean the leather, mix a solution of warm water and dish soap. Dip a soft cloth into the solution, wring it out and wipe the exterior surfaces of the purse. Use a second clean, damp cloth to wipe off the soap. Dry with a towel.

What type of leather is best for handbags?

When purchasing a leather handbag, cowhide leather is considered to be the highest quality material available. Not only is cowhide leather extremely durable, but it also looks aesthetically appealing. When you touch cow skin leather, you should be able to feel the roughness.
